> The entity "kappa" was as stated earlier for any XML file (not just XSL) if you use an entity reference other than teh five built in ones you need to define it. If your source file contained undefined reference and doesn't habe a <!DOCTYPE that references a dtd then it is not well formed, and no XML application will be able to process it.
